免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app的开发环境的搭建

移动应用程序(App)的开发环境可以在多种操作系统中搭建,包括Windows、MacOS、Linux等等。然而,不同的平台有不同的开发环境和编译工具,因此需要根据不同平台的特点进行不同的设置。下面将分别介绍在Windows、MacOS、Linux平台上搭建App开发环境的步骤。

1. 在Windows平台上搭建App开发环境

在Windows平台上,最通用和流行的开发环境是使用Google推出的Android Studio。在安装Android Studio之前,需要确认计算机的配置是否符合要求。Android Studio及其相关工具的最低系统需求包括:

- Windows7/8/10(32-bit or 64-bit)

- 2 GB RAM minimum, 4 GB RAM recommended

- 2 GB of available disk space minimum, 4 GB Recommended (500 MB for IDE + 1.5 GB for Android SDK and emulator system image)

- 1280 x 800 minimum screen resolution

下载并安装Android Studio的步骤如下:

1.在浏览器中打开Google的官方网站,搜索Android Studio并下载最新的版本。

2.使用安装文件安装Android Studio。

3.在安装的过程中,需要选择所需的组件。其中至少需要安装Android SDK与Android Virtual Device(AVD)。

4.完成后启动Android Studio,按照界面提示安装最新版本的Android SDK。

5.创建Android项目并开始开发。

2. 在MacOS上搭建App开发环境

在MacOS上,App开发环境同样需要使用Android Studio。安装Android Studio前,在确认MacOS的配置符合Android Studio的系统需求。如下:

- Mac® OS X® 10.10 (Yosemite) or higher, up to 10.13 (macOS High Sierra)

- 2 GB RAM minimum, 4 GB RAM recommended

- 2 GB of available disk space minimum,

- 1280 x 800 minimum screen resolution, 1440 x 900 or higher recommended

- JDK 8

安装Android Studio的步骤如下:

1.访问Google的官方网站,搜索Android Studio并下载最新版本。

2.安装Android Studio。

3.启动Android Studio并完成初始设置。

4.按照界面提示安装最新版本的Android SDK,并创建Android项目以开始开发。

3. 在Linux上搭建App开发环境

在Linux上搭建App开发环境需要首先安装OpenJDK和几个其他的开发库和工具。以下是实现此目标的步骤:

1.启动Terminal。

2.输入如下命令安装OpenJDK:

sudo apt-get update

sudo apt-get install openjdk-8-jdk

3.一旦安装了OpenJDK,可以通过输入如下命令来验证安装是否成功:

javac -version

java -version

4.安装Android SDK:

进入https://developer.android.google.cn/studio/,下载最新版本的SDK。

解压缩SDK安装包并将其放在所需目录下。

5.设置环境变量:

在您的~/.bashrc或~/.bash_profile 中添加以下行:

export ANDROID_SDK_HOME=/path/to/sdk

export PATH=$PATH:$ANDROID_SDK_HOME/tools

export PATH=$PATH:$ANDROID_SDK_HOME/platform-tools

6.启动Android Studio并创建Android项目以开始开发。

在不同平台上搭建App开发环境的过程略有不同,但都遵循了相同的基本原则,需要先安装必要的开发工具和库,然后根据需要配置开发环境和调试工具。通过本文的介绍,开发者可以了解到如何在Windows、MacOS和Linux平台上搭建App开发环境的步骤和流程,为实际开发提供了帮助。


相关知识:
如何开发app之产品设计
App产品设计是一项非常重要的工作,它关乎到整个App的用户体验和市场竞争力。在进行App产品设计之前,我们需要明确自己的目标用户、市场需求、竞争对手等信息,以此为基础进行产品设计。本文将从需求分析、用户体验、界面设计和功能设计四个方面介绍App产品设计的
2024-01-10
java学习了可以开发手机app吗
Java是一种通用的计算机编程语言,也是移动应用开发领域中最常用的语言之一。通过使用Java开发平台,开发人员可以创建功能丰富的手机应用程序。在使用Java开发手机应用程序之前,首先需要掌握Java编程语言的基础知识。这包括理解Java的语法、变量、运算符
2023-07-14
ionic如何开发app
Ionic是一个用于开发跨平台移动应用的开源框架。它使用现代化的Web技术,如HTML、CSS和JavaScript来构建应用程序,并通过Cordova或Capacitor将应用程序打包为原生应用。首先,你需要安装一些必要的工具和软件来开始Ionic开发。
2023-07-14
app开发失败案例和因素
标题:探讨APP开发失败案例及其因素引言:在移动互联网时代,APP开发已成为企业发展和用户服务的重要手段。然而,随着APP市场竞争的加剧,许多开发项目最终以失败告终。本文将分析一些APP开发失败的案例,并探讨造成这些失败的原因。一、案例分析1. Color
2023-06-29
apple正在开发卫星
近日,据外媒报道,苹果正在积极开发卫星技术,旨在为公司的设备提供更好的无线网络连接和更准确的位置服务。据悉,目前苹果已经组建了一个专门的工程团队,负责研发卫星技术,并且已经开展了相关的实验。那么,这项技术的原理是什么,苹果具体是如何实现的呢?首先,我们需要
2023-05-06
android sdk开发和app开发
Android SDK开发和App开发是移动应用开发领域中非常重要的两个方面,本文将对它们的原理和详细介绍进行讲解。Android SDK开发Android SDK是Android软件开发套件的简称,它提供了一组可编程的应用程序接口(API)和开发工具,使
2023-05-06